IMCOM Commander Wants BRAC to Rid Army of Excess Infrastructure

IMCOM Commander Wants BRAC to Rid Army of Excess Infrastructure

WASHINGTON (Army News Service, April 27, 2015) - Another round of base realignment and closure was called for by the Army's top installation management officer as a way to rid the service of excess infrastructure and modernize facilities. The Army has drawn down the active-duty force by 80,000 Soldiers already, and expects to have an active-duty end strength of 490,000 … [Read more...]

Composites Key to Tougher, Lighter Armaments

Composites Key to Tougher, Lighter Armaments

BALTIMORE (Army News Service, April 23, 2015) - The Army is on the cusp of revolutionizing materials that go into armament construction, making for stronger, lighter and more durable weapons, Dr. Andrew Littlefield said. The key to this revolution is composite materials, said Littlefield, who is a mechanical engineer at the U.S. Army Armament Research, Development and … [Read more...]

Air National Guard Unveils New Bonus Program

MARCH 11, 2023 – On March 1st, the Air National Guard (ANG) launched a new bonus program to attract and retain personnel in critical specialties. The initiative offers significant financial rewards, with bonuses of up to $90,000 for eligible members, depending on their Air Force Specialty Codes (AFSCs). This strategic move aims to strengthen the […]
